I recently re-installed the wiper motor and mechanism on my AE86, on the arm that is connected to the wiper motor there is a small metal tab just off the ball joint housing (ball joint housing is underneath the rubber boot). This tab can be used to anchor the arm on the edge of the round hole when popping the ball back into it's housing as it is difficult to provide resistance to the rear of the arm (very confined space behind it), it could also be used in anchoring the arm when popping the ball out.
